Specification
| 2.4 ghz: | Yes | 
|---|---|
| 5 ghz: | Yes | 
| 6 ghz: | No | 
| Access control list (acl): | Yes | 
| Antenna direction type: | Omni-directional | 
| Antenna gain level (max): | 5 dBi | 
| Antenna type: | Internal | 
| Antennas quantity: | 6 | 
| Automatic channel scanning: | Yes | 
| Automatic channel selection: | Yes | 
| Band steering: | Yes | 
| Beamforming: | Yes | 
| Depth: | 243 mm | 
| Ethernet lan data rates: | 2500 Mbit/s | 
| Firmware upgradeable: | Yes | 
| Frequency band: | 2.4 - 5 GHz | 
| Harmonized system (hs) code: | 85176990 | 
| Height: | 64 mm | 
| Input current: | 1.5 A | 
| International protection (ip) code: | IP67 | 
| Led indicators: | Yes | 
| Maximum data transfer rate: | 5400 Mbit/s | 
| Maximum data transfer rate (2.4 ghz): | 574 Mbit/s | 
| Maximum data transfer rate (5 ghz): | 4804 Mbit/s | 
| Mimo: | Yes | 
| Mimo type: | Multi User MIMO | 
| Networking standards: | IEEE 802.11b, IEEE 802.11g, IEEE 802.11n, IEEE 802.11a, IEEE 802.11ac, IEEE 802.11ax | 
| Number of products included: | 1 pc(s) | 
| Number of ssid supported: | 16 | 
| Number of users: | 250 user(s) | 
| Package depth: | 304 mm | 
| Package height: | 82 mm | 
| Package weight: | 1.32 kg | 
| Package width: | 302 mm | 
| Placement: | Ceiling, Wall | 
| Power over ethernet (poe): | Yes | 
| Product colour: | White | 
| Quality of service (qos) support: | Yes | 
| Quantity per pack: | 1 pc(s) | 
| Rate limiting: | Yes | 
| Remote authentication dial-in user service (radius): | Yes | 
| Reset button: | Yes | 
| Service set identifier (ssid) features: | Multiple SSIDs | 
| Transmitting power (ce): | <20 dBm(2.4 GHz, EIRP); <23 dBm(5 GHz, band1 & band2, EIRP); <30 dBm(5 GHz, band3, EIRP) | 
| Transmitting power (fcc): | <25 dBm (2.4 GHz); <28 dBm (5 GHz) | 
| Vlan support: | No | 
| Web-based management: | Yes | 
| Width: | 243 mm | 
| Wireless isolation: | Yes |
